Netherlands - Density of Practising Physicians

Since 2014, Netherlands Density of Practising Physicians increased 1.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 14 among other countries in Density of Practising Physicians at 3.67 Units (Health Professionnals) Per Thousand Persons. Netherlands is overtaken by Australia, which was number 13 at 3.8 Units (Health Professionnals) Per Thousand Persons and is followed by Estonia with 3.5 Units (Health Professionnals) Per Thousand Persons. Austria ranked the highest with 5.3 Units (Health Professionnals) Per Thousand Persons in 2019, that is an increase of 1.2% compared to 2018. Norway, Lithuania and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. China recorded the best 5 years average growth at +3.9% per year, while Russia witnessed the worst performance at -0.6% per year.
